Below is an overview of the Advanced Driver Education Program as it occurs over the course of three evenings.

The Classroom normally runs from approximately 6:30 PM to 8:30 PM with the South End and Full Track evenings going from approximately 5:00 PM to 9:00 PM.

Evening # 1 Classroom
The classroom will be approximately 2 hours long and cover the theory of high performance driving.

The main focus will be on safety and an understanding of the buzzwords and techniques we use on the racetrack. The classroom also gives us an excellent opportunity to relate High Performance techniques back to our everyday street driving such as seating position, correct use of mirrors, braking and cornering techniques.

Evening # 2 South End
The second evening will be on the south end of the road course from 5 pm to 9 pm.

We will introduce and work on:

     Vehicle Control

     Heel & Toe Downshifting

     Braking/Correct use of ABS systems

     Accident Avoidance

     Cornering and line interpretation

     Weight transfer and the effects on vehicle dynamics

     How to identify and understand the work zone of a corner

     Throttle steer and maintaining the balance of the car

     Understanding early and late apex corners

Evening # 3 Full Track
On the third evening we will introduce the full road course and continue with the skills from evening # 2

The main focus for the third evening will be:

     Cornering and line interpretation 

     Understanding Weight transfer and the effects of vehicle dynamics with increased speed.

     Becoming more efficient in the work zone.

     Throttle steer and maintaining the balance of the car  

Also included is a High Performance driving manual, and the use of a helmet. After finishing a 3-day program the graduate will have an opportunity to take part in lapping events on the full 3.2 km Road Course at Race City Motorsport Park.
